North's fishermen unhappy with cuts in EU quotas

Fishermen in the North are complaining about the latest EU deal on annual fishing quotas.

They are facing a 10% reduction in prawn catches and an 18% reduction for the whitefish fleet.

There will also be a cut of 18% in the amount of cod that can be caught, but an increase in the amount of haddock.

Fisheries Minister Michelle Gildernew says the EU had proposed bigger cuts, but fishermen say they are being put out of business.
